The Rise of Streaming and OTT Platforms
Streaming is no longer the future; it's the present. Over-the-top (OTT) platforms like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, and Disney+ have revolutionized the way people consume content. The World Broadcaster Meeting 2025 will delve into the strategies that traditional broadcasters can employ to compete with these digital giants. Discussions will likely revolve around developing compelling original content, leveraging data analytics to personalize user experiences, and exploring new revenue models such as subscriptions and advertising. The meeting will also examine the impact of streaming on traditional broadcasting infrastructure and the need for regulatory frameworks that address the unique challenges posed by OTT platforms. For instance, how can broadcasters leverage their existing assets to create their own streaming services? What are the most effective ways to acquire and retain subscribers in a crowded market? These are just some of the questions that will be explored.
Artificial Intelligence (AI) in Broadcasting
AI is transforming industries across the board, and broadcasting is no exception. From content creation to distribution and audience engagement, AI offers a plethora of opportunities to enhance efficiency and improve the viewer experience. The World Broadcaster Meeting 2025 will showcase cutting-edge AI applications in broadcasting, such as automated content generation, personalized recommendations, and real-time analytics. Experts will discuss how AI can be used to streamline workflows, reduce costs, and create more engaging content. However, the meeting will also address the ethical considerations surrounding AI, such as bias in algorithms and the potential for job displacement. It's all about leveraging AI's power while being mindful of its pitfalls.

Networking Like a Pro
Networking is a crucial part of any conference, and the World Broadcaster Meeting is no exception. To make meaningful connections, start by setting clear goals. What do you hope to achieve by networking? Are you looking for potential partners, new clients, or simply to expand your industry knowledge? Once you know your goals, you can focus your efforts on meeting the right people. Don't be afraid to approach strangers. Introduce yourself, explain your role, and ask about their work. Listen actively and show genuine interest in what they have to say. Follow up with your new contacts after the meeting. Send a personalized email or connect on LinkedIn. Nurturing these relationships can lead to valuable opportunities down the road.
